Vinnie Falco
|
e132aabdae
|
Use boost for functional when the config is set
|
2013-09-28 15:09:10 -07:00 |
|
Vinnie Falco
|
5c5de57290
|
Reorganize beast modules and files
|
2013-09-23 10:13:24 -07:00 |
|
Vinnie Falco
|
57703acf75
|
Fix BeforeBoost.h include
|
2013-09-22 11:52:26 -07:00 |
|
Vinnie Falco
|
c0ca0373b6
|
Remove Beast version printing on startup
|
2013-09-20 00:57:55 -07:00 |
|
Vinnie Falco
|
7efb6a3ab8
|
Reorganize some MPL and Utility classes and files
|
2013-09-19 21:37:47 -07:00 |
|
Vinnie Falco
|
72fc42b60c
|
Move and add some template metaprogramming classes
|
2013-09-19 14:42:54 -07:00 |
|
Vinnie Falco
|
ebbd9ff414
|
Move TargetPlatform.h to beast/Config.h
|
2013-09-19 14:42:52 -07:00 |
|
Vinnie Falco
|
02acf7d6d0
|
General refactoring of beast framework classes
|
2013-09-12 10:55:24 -07:00 |
|
Vinnie Falco
|
8b1b6050e7
|
Put back BEAST_CATCH_UNHANDLED_EXCEPTIONS macro, but disabled by default
|
2013-09-10 08:04:46 -07:00 |
|
Vinnie Falco
|
4676db126a
|
Remove BEAST_CATCH_UNHANDLED_EXCEPTIONS
|
2013-09-09 13:34:18 -07:00 |
|
Vinnie Falco
|
10958459a3
|
Add BEAST_MOVE_* macros
|
2013-09-07 11:53:35 -07:00 |
|
Vinnie Falco
|
04a4219a75
|
Make bassert fatal
|
2013-09-06 21:29:16 -07:00 |
|
Vinnie Falco
|
96587dc68c
|
Add BeforeBoost.h and tidy up beast system headers
|
2013-09-01 12:22:08 -07:00 |
|
Vinnie Falco
|
d9d291abcb
|
Tidy up includes and header material
|
2013-08-30 17:33:33 -07:00 |
|
Vinnie Falco
|
38516ef793
|
Tidy up beast project files
|
2013-08-30 17:24:32 -07:00 |
|
Vinnie Falco
|
5002ab2169
|
Merge beast_basics to beast_core
|
2013-08-24 10:18:24 -07:00 |
|
Vinnie Falco
|
69f0eb109f
|
Add BEAST_DEFINE_IS_CALL_POSSIBLE metaprogramming macro
|
2013-08-15 16:57:45 -07:00 |
|
Vinnie Falco
|
9aaaa6aef0
|
Make Uncopyable derivations public
|
2013-08-07 15:16:38 -07:00 |
|
Vinnie Falco
|
4c987d04d6
|
Add tests for SSE3 capability
|
2013-07-31 16:35:52 -07:00 |
|
Vinnie Falco
|
cb47146b3b
|
Add classes ProtectedCall and Main
|
2013-07-28 14:58:19 -07:00 |
|
Vinnie Falco
|
caa3a5d0bb
|
Replace calls to deprecated siginterrupt()
|
2013-07-10 09:51:26 -07:00 |
|
Vinnie Falco
|
9e75075dc4
|
Adjust a comment
|
2013-07-10 09:51:24 -07:00 |
|
Vinnie Falco
|
3fea8a4202
|
Rename SharedSingleton and move files around
|
2013-07-01 09:32:05 -07:00 |
|
Vinnie Falco
|
ca1eda2df1
|
Use LeakChecked throughout Beast
|
2013-07-01 09:32:04 -07:00 |
|
Vinnie Falco
|
386fea5e71
|
Tidy up and activate the MSVC Debug Heap
|
2013-07-01 09:32:03 -07:00 |
|
Vinnie Falco
|
e7bda30506
|
Large tidying up of Beast
- Move key classes into beast_core
- Tidy up various macros and files
- Disable leaking FifoFreeStoreWithTLS
|
2013-07-01 09:32:03 -07:00 |
|
Vinnie Falco
|
74e8c881f7
|
Add missing native BSD support for Beast
|
2013-06-26 09:24:44 -07:00 |
|
Vinnie Falco
|
6d13ddd43a
|
Fix Clang static analysis warnings
|
2013-06-26 00:19:41 -07:00 |
|
Vinnie Falco
|
86142ecdf1
|
Add BEAST_ARM macro to detect ARM platforms
|
2013-06-23 09:18:58 -07:00 |
|
Vinnie Falco
|
8cdc00230d
|
Add BEAST_FILEANDLINE_ macro for warning pragmas
|
2013-06-23 09:18:58 -07:00 |
|
Vinnie Falco
|
d3d674ba4b
|
Beast fixes for FreeBSD
|
2013-06-20 13:38:44 -07:00 |
|
Vinnie Falco
|
d0a309e6da
|
Add beast_basics module
|
2013-06-17 07:09:33 -07:00 |
|
Vinnie Falco
|
f2d84f0a90
|
Add Beast fork from JUCE commit 265fb0e8ebc26e1469d6edcc68d2ca9acefeb508
|
2013-06-16 16:57:52 -07:00 |
|